Q: Incremental rebuilds on Staticore are stuck — what now?

A: Check the Larkfield build queue first; stale lockfiles are the usual cause. Clear them and retrigger the changed-pages job. If the content hash store is sealed (happens after node crashes), unseal it from the ops shell. It will prompt for the recovery passphrase, shown below.

strongbox words: pelok-istax-norir-quenius-keleth-quenys

Subject: Branchsweep bot — new owner

On-call: the stale-branch cleanup bot (Branchsweep) has changed hands. It runs nightly, deletes branches idle 90+ days, and occasionally mis-flags release branches. If it pages or deletes something it shouldn't, don't restore manually — use the recovery script in the runbook. Page the new owner first. That owner is listed below.

account owner for fajep-yagef: Kasix Eliiel

### Release checklist — Scanwick barcode integration

Hey reviewer — before you sign off, make sure the Scanwick handheld pairing flow survives a mid-scan disconnect and that EAN-13 checksums are rejected (not silently truncated) when malformed. We had a nasty regression there last quarter. Also confirm the debounce window is 150ms so double-trigger scanners don't duplicate line items in the Ledgerbird POS. Once those pass locally, attach your results to the ticket with the build token shown below.

pipeline stamp: htk31_f769b577b3028a4e9958e5bb8d1259a

Handover for eng sync — Dalewood pooler

Short version: I moved the Dalewood API off per-request connections onto the shared pooler last Tuesday. p95 query latency down 60%, but we saw pool exhaustion during the Friday batch window. Mitigation: batch jobs now use a separate pool with a lower cap. Idle timeout was too aggressive; bumped it. Watch the saturation dashboard after Thursday's deploy — if waits exceed 50ms, page me, not ops. Current pool configuration follows.

service settings:
[casax]
port = 6379
team = rusir
host = casax.zemvarhq.corp
region = outer-4
access_code = ac_9808ce
timeout_ms = 1500

TURN-208: Gatevale turnstile counters at the Merrow Field pilot double-count when a rotation reverses mid-cycle. Attendance totals drift roughly 2% high per event. The debounce window fix is implemented, reviewed by Ilsa, and soak-tested across two simulated match days without drift. Ready for your cut; the candidate build is identified below.

trace token, tagag-tafog: htk6_5ed18c